The Mirror Took Her πŸͺž

They said the legend was just a game - say "Bloody Mary" three times in the dark, and she might appear. But the old farmhouse on the edge of town had a mirror that wasn't just glass. It was a door.

Four teens snuck in after midnight, the air thick with dust and rot. They lit a single flashlight and stood before the towering, black-spotted mirror rumored to be the last thing Mary ever saw before she was murdered. They laughed to hide their nerves and chanted her name.

The light died.

In the reflection, they could still see themselves, dim and flickering, but they weren't moving. Their mirrored selves stared back with stretched, grey faces and eyes full of blood. One girl turned to run, but in the mirror, her reflection only smiled, teeth long and red.

Something moved behind the glass, a woman, shaped shadow with nails like broken glass and hair dripping dark, clotting streaks. A hand pressed out from the inside of the mirror, distorting the surface like water, and grabbed the girl who stood closest.

She didn't scream long. She was yanked through the surface as if it swallowed her whole. The others bolted, but their reflections remained on the other side, smiling wider and wider… until the mirror went still.

The next day, the farmhouse was empty, except for a fresh handprint on the glass. And the faint sound of someone scratching to get out.
